What is Termite Baiting System?
Termite Baiting System is a great way to protect your home from termites, one of the most destructive pests in the world. These systems use specialized bait placed around the perimeter of your house and often require repeated visits by professionals to make sure that everything is working properly. The bait acts as both detection and control, with low levels of material toxic to termites being released when the bait gets eaten – this then allows for infestations to be treated early before they can cause any serious damage to your home’s structure. In most cases, these systems offer a more natural solution than chemical treatments and are safer for people, pets and the environment.
